Rose A. Sudacki

Rose A. Sudacki, 88, of 8 Baskin Lane died Saturday evening at Mount Greylock Extended Care Facility in Pittsfield. Born in Adams on July 23, 1914, daughter of Joseph and Anna Kciuk Dobrowolski, she was a 1933 graduate of the former Adams High School. She was employed in the Tantalum division of the former Sprague Electric Co. in North Adams, retiring in 1976 after 31 years of service. Earlier, she had worked for the former Berkshire Fine Spinning Co. Mrs. Sudacki was a communicant of St. Stanislaus' Church and a member of its Rosary Sodality. She was also a member of the Polish Women's Club and the Adams Senior Citizens. Her husband, William Sudacki, whom she married May 3, 1947, died Jan. 9, 1968. She leaves a brother, Casimer Dobrowolski of Pittsfield. A daughter, Susan Sudacki, died in infancy in 1953. FUNERAL NOTICE -- The funeral for Rose Sudacki will be Wednesday at 9:15 from AUGE-PACIOREK-SIMMONS FUNERAL HOME, 13 Hoosac St., Adams, followed by a Liturgy of Christian Burial at 10 at St. Stanislaus Kostka Church celebrated by the Rev. Eugene Suszek, pastor. Burial will follow in St. Stanislaus Kostka Cemetery. Calling hours will be tomorrow from 5 to 7 at the funeral home. Memorial donations may be made to St. Stanislaus' Church through the funeral home. She was predeceased by three brothers, Emil, Stanley and John Dobrowolski, and a sister, Helen Drobiak.
